Output 14df02828fa7bd6a350dee69217938c6019adc4c7016f832b14a06b70a078972:4

value
100967153
script pubkey
OP_0 OP_PUSHBYTES_32 b3929856742d8fce7591950543666f464e5f7eb8361d0775968e71697f7323af
address
bc1qkwffs4n59k8uuav3j5z5xen0ge897l4cxcwswavk3eckjlmnywhsxl4t7x
transaction
14df02828fa7bd6a350dee69217938c6019adc4c7016f832b14a06b70a078972
confirmations
148655
spent
true